The Mechanics Behind Future Automated Parking Enforcement

As cities grapple with increasing traffic congestion and parking violations, the future automated parking enforcement systems are emerging as a solution. These systems utilize technologies like automatic license plate recognition (ALPR), artificial intelligence (AI), and connected sensors to monitor car spaces in real-time. When a violation occurs—such as parking in a no-parking zone or exceeding time limits—enforcement officers receive instant alerts, and fines can be issued automatically through digital platforms.

The rationale for implementing these systems is compelling. According to a report from the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ration, parking violations contribute significantly to urban congestion, costing cities approximately $25 billion annually in lost productivity. By automating enforcement, cities can reduce the need for physical patrols and allocate resources more efficiently, significantly lowering operational costs.

To prepare for this shift, municipalities should assess their existing infrastructure, establish guidelines for system implementation, and train staff for the transition. It is critical to navigate legal implications, as automated systems must comply with local laws regarding surveillance and data privacy. Common mistakes include neglecting community input and failing to plan for the integration of these technologies into existing enforcement frameworks. By addressing these key areas, cities can effectively transition into the era of automated parking management.

Understanding the Risks of Future Automated Parking Enforcement

The future automated parking enforcement landscape presents distinct challenges and opportunities within parking environments, including lots, garages, and metered street zones. As cities increasingly adopt technology to monitor compliance, the risks associated with enforcement methodologies become clearer. For instance, reliance on automated systems can lead to misinterpretation of data, such as incorrectly identifying vehicles in violation due to technological errors. This can disproportionately affect parking situations, where vehicles may be parked legally but flagged inaccurately by software. Moreover, automated systems may overlook unique scenarios often encountered in parking garages or lots, such as temporary loading zones or vehicles with special permits. These oversights can lead to an increase in disputes and penalties, resulting in public dissatisfaction and decreased compliance. Maintaining an understanding of the official parking rules is essential for both drivers and enforcement agencies to mitigate these risks. Accurate data collection and analysis will be crucial in crafting fair enforcement policies. As cities strive for smarter urban mobility, addressing parking accessibility challenges becomes vital. Automated systems must evolve to accommodate diverse needs, ensuring that regulations support rather than hinder access for all users. This evolution will significantly shape the future of parking enforcement, making it more equitable and effective.
